About Linwei Sang
Linwei Sang is a scholar working on Electrical and Electronic Engineering, Control and Systems Engineering, Safety, Risk, Reliability and Quality, Automotive Engineering and Civil and Structural Engineering, having authored 25 papers that have together received 315 indexed citations. Recurring topics across this work include Smart Grid Energy Management (8 papers), Electric Power System Optimization (5 papers), Optimal Power Flow Distribution (5 papers), Integrated Energy Systems Optimization (4 papers), Electric Vehicles and Infrastructure (3 papers), Microgrid Control and Optimization (3 papers), Smart Grid Security and Resilience (3 papers) and Power System Reliability and Maintenance (3 papers). The work is most often cited by research in Energy Engineering and Power Technology (31 citations), Control and Systems Engineering (110 citations), Electrical and Electronic Engineering (235 citations), Safety, Risk, Reliability and Quality (27 citations) and Automotive Engineering (15 citations). Linwei Sang has collaborated with scholars based in China, Hong Kong and United States. Frequent co-authors include Yinliang Xu, Huan Long, Hongbin Sun, Zhongkai Yi, Huaizhi Wang, Zaijun Wu, Wei Gu, Qinran Hu, Jichen Zhang and Wenchuan Wu. Their work appears in journals such as IEEE Transactions on Sustainable Energy, IEEE Transactions on Smart Grid, IEEE Transactions on Power Systems, Applied Energy and IEEE Transactions on Automation Science and Engineering.
